diff --git a/src/WPDesk/Notice/Factory.php b/src/WPDesk/Notice/Factory.php index b342aa06405a4480615d57b572990ea1b9020b94..90d024e4f3482eca0cb16718ad2b816e326e6e1a 100644 --- a/src/WPDesk/Notice/Factory.php +++ b/src/WPDesk/Notice/Factory.php @@ -23,6 +23,7 @@ class Factory */ public static function notice($noticeContent = '', $noticeType = 'info', $isDismissible = false, $priority = 10) { +error_log(14); return new Notice($noticeContent, $noticeType, $isDismissible, $priority); } diff --git a/src/WPDesk/Notice/Notice.php b/src/WPDesk/Notice/Notice.php index ce34a34038c3704c58c40c71f0124067d61d4099..7b774f67061850410f8bca6e4c6005216135d524 100644 --- a/src/WPDesk/Notice/Notice.php +++ b/src/WPDesk/Notice/Notice.php @@ -75,6 +75,7 @@ class Notice $priority = 10, $attributes = array() ) { +error_log(15); $this->noticeContent = $noticeContent; $this->noticeType = $noticeType; $this->dismissible = $dismissible; @@ -156,7 +157,9 @@ class Notice */ protected function addAction() { +error_log(16); if (!$this->actionAdded) { +error_log(17); add_action('admin_notices', [$this, 'showNotice'], $this->priority); add_action( 'admin_footer', @@ -247,7 +250,7 @@ class Notice */ public function showNotice() { -error_log(11); +error_log(51); $this->removeAction(); $noticeFormat = '<div %1$s>%2$s</div>'; if ($this->addParagraphToContent()) { diff --git a/src/WPDesk/notice-functions.php b/src/WPDesk/notice-functions.php index ca810c57f33136f6394a40908a0182155784a04e..cf83d71fbb133697451cbd87b87f9c0295222e7a 100644 --- a/src/WPDesk/notice-functions.php +++ b/src/WPDesk/notice-functions.php @@ -13,6 +13,7 @@ if (!function_exists('WPDeskNotice')) { */ function WPDeskNotice($noticeContent, $noticeType = 'info', $dismissible = false, $priority = 10) { +error_log(12); return \WPDesk\Notice\Factory::notice($noticeContent, $noticeType, $dismissible, $priority); } } @@ -32,6 +33,7 @@ if (!function_exists('wpdesk_notice')) { */ function wpdesk_notice($noticeContent, $noticeType = 'info', $dismissible = false, $priority = 10) { +error_log(11); return WPDeskNotice($noticeContent, $noticeType, $dismissible, $priority); } }